Subject: Your cage visit on Thursday — Harrowgate Data Centre

Hello,

Thank you for confirming your maintenance visit to the Vextral cage at Harrowgate. Please arrive at the front desk fifteen minutes early with photo identification and your signed works order. You will be escorted through the mantrap by a duty technician; tools must be declared at the desk. Once inside the cold aisle, the cage gate requires the access code provided below.

turnstile pass: bdg-QZV-3

Changelog — Relayloft 4.2

Changed defaults: websocket compression (permessage-deflate) is now off by default. Profiling showed CPU cost on small, frequent frames outweighed bandwidth savings for most tenants, and context takeover caused memory spikes on the Harwick edge nodes. Enable it per-connection only for large payloads. The new defaults shipped to all tiers are as follows.

service settings:
WENATH_PIN=5007
WENATH_METRICS_HOST=metrics.wenath.tolvaqlabs.corp
WENATH_LOG_LEVEL=debug
WENATH_TENANT=rusox

Q3 Planning Note — Board Only

Verrato Systems continues to dispute our license terms for the Kestrel Mapping Suite. Their counsel claims our 2022 addendum voided exclusivity in the Halwick region. Ours disagrees. Mediation is set for early next quarter; litigation reserve raised accordingly. Revenue exposure capped at roughly 4% of annual recurring income. Sales of Kestrel continue uninterrupted in all other territories. We recommend no public comment until mediation concludes. The confidential outline of our fallback position follows below.

internal memo for yahag-hahig: Belwynix Group plans to lower the Silir list price by 62 percent in May.